    Throughout the physical examination, your doctor might check your muscle strength and reflexes (best treatment for sciatica). For example, you may be asked to stroll on your toes or heels, rise from a crouching position and, while lying on your back, raise your legs one at a time. Pain that arises from sciatica will normally worsen throughout these activities.

    So physicians don't usually buy these tests unless your pain is severe, or it does not improve within a few weeks. An X-ray of your spine may expose an overgrowth of bone (bone spur) that may be continuing a nerve. This procedure utilizes an effective magnet and radio waves to produce cross-sectional images of your back.

    During the test, you push a table that moves into the MRI machine. When a CT is used to image the spinal column, you might have a contrast color injected into your spinal canal prior to the X-rays are taken a treatment called a CT myelogram - sciatica treatment at home. The dye then circulates around your spine and back nerves, which appear white on the scan.

    This test can validate nerve compression triggered by herniated disks or narrowing of your back canal (back stenosis). If your discomfort does not enhance with self-care procedures, your physician may suggest a few of the following treatments. The kinds of drugs that may be prescribed for sciatica pain include: Anti-inflammatories Muscle relaxants Narcotics Tricyclic antidepressants Anti-seizure medications When your sharp pain enhances, your medical professional or a physical therapist can design a rehab program to help you prevent future injuries (sciatica natural treatment).

    Sometimes, your physician might suggest injection of a corticosteroid medication into the area around the included nerve root. Corticosteroids assist decrease pain by suppressing inflammation around the inflamed nerve. The impacts typically disappear in a few months. sciatica home treatment. The variety of steroid injections you can receive is restricted due to the fact that the threat of major adverse effects increases when the injections occur too frequently.

    Cosmetic surgeons can get rid of the bone spur or the part of the herniated disk that's continuing the pinched nerve. For most individuals, sciatica reacts to self-care measures. treatment sciatica. Although resting for a day approximately might offer some relief, extended inactivity will make your symptoms and signs worse. Other self-care treatments that might assist include: At first, you may get relief from an ice bag placed on the agonizing location for as much as 20 minutes several times a day.

    After 2 to 3 days, use heat to the areas that hurt. Usage hot packs, a heat lamp or a heating pad on the least expensive setting. If you continue to have pain, attempt alternating warm and cold packs. Extending exercises for your low back can assist you feel better and may assist ease nerve root compression - treatment sciatica.

    Painkiller such as ibuprofen (Advil, Motrin IB, others) and naproxen salt (Aleve) are in some cases helpful for sciatica. Alternative therapies commonly used for low pain in the back consist of: In acupuncture, the professional inserts hair-thin needles into your skin at particular points on your body - treatment sciatica. Some studies have recommended that acupuncture can assist pain in the back, while others have actually discovered no benefit (sciatica pain treatment).

    Spine change (adjustment) is one form of therapy chiropractic practitioners use to deal with limited back mobility (sciatica nerve treatment). The goal is to restore spinal motion and, as a result, improve function and decrease discomfort (sciatica home treatment). Spinal adjustment appears to be as efficient and safe as standard treatments for low neck and back pain, but may not be suitable for radiating pain.

    Sciatica is pain that begins in your lower back and shoots down through your legs and often into your feet. It takes place when something in your body-- possibly a herniated disk or bone spur compresses your sciatic nerve. Some people experience sharp, extreme discomfort, and others get tingling, weakness, and pins and needles in their legs.

    The majority of people with sciatica don't end up requiring surgery, and about half improve within 6 weeks with just rest and medication - sciatica natural treatment. So what do you require to do after your doctor makes a diagnosis of sciatica?Most people with sciatica improve in a few weeks with at-home treatments. If your pain is relatively mild and it isn't stopping you from doing your daily activities, your physician will initially suggest trying some mix of these standard services.

    You can help relieve your sciatica pain with lower-back stretches.Inflammation can improvewhen you remain in motion, so short walks can be a great concept. Your physiotherapist can ensure your kind is correct so you do not injure yourself any even more. Three day of rests your feet normally works, and it is necessary to be on a firm mattress or the flooring. Use each for several minutes on your.

    lower back, a couple of times a day. Ice bag first for a few days, then heat loads. Lots of people think that alternative therapies like yoga, massage, biofeedback, and acupuncture assistance with sciatica. Yourvery first alternative ought to be over the counter painkiller. Acetaminophen and NSAIDs( n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s) like aspirin, ibuprofen, and naproxen are very practical, however you shouldn't use them for extended durations without speaking toyour doctor. Tricyclic antidepressants such as amitriptyline( Elavil )and anti- seizure medications often work, too.

    Steroid injections directly into the irritated nerve can likewise supply you with minimal relief. Whenall else stops working, surgical treatment is the last option for about 5% to 10% of people with sciatica. If you have milder sciatica however are still in pain after 3 months of resting, extending, and taking medication, you and your doctor most likely will need to talk about surgery. That's a straight-to-surgery circumstance. chiropractic treatment for sciatica. The two primary surgical options for sciatica are diskectomy and laminectomy. During this procedureyour surgeon gets rid of whatever is continuing your sciatic nerve, whether it's a herniated disk, a bone spur, or something else. The objective is to get rid of only the piece that's in fact causing the sciatica, however often surgeons have to eliminate the whole disk to fix the concern. The lamina is part of the ring of bone that covers the spine. During a laminectomy, your cosmetic surgeon removes the lamina and any tissue pressing on.

    the nerve that's triggering you pain. You will get basic anesthesia, suggesting you will not be awake during the operation, which can last up to 2 hours. Often, the most troublesome body parts are the lower back and hips.Dr. Mark Kovacs , a licensed strength and conditioning specialist, adds that the best way to relieve most sciatica pain isto do" any stretch that can externally turn the hip to offer some relief." Here are 6 exercises that do simply that: reclining pigeon posesitting pigeon poseforward pigeon poseknee to opposite shouldersittingback stretchstanding hamstring stretchPigeon pose is a common yoga posture. There are multiple versions of this stretch. sciatica treatment exercises. The first is a beginning variation called the reclining pigeon pose. If you're simply starting your treatment, you need to try the reclining pose initially. While on your back, bring your ideal leg up to an ideal angle. Clasp both hands behind the thigh, locking your fingers. Hold the position for a moment.

    This assists extend the tiny piriformis muscle, which sometimes becomes swollen and presses against the sciatic nerve, triggering pain. Do the same workout with the other leg. When you can do the reclining version without pain, deal with your physiotherapist on the sitting and forward variations of pigeon pose.
